YUM命令快速卸载MySQL数据库
yum 删除 mysql数据库

首页 2025-07-21 16:15:23



高效管理Linux系统:如何彻底卸载MySQL数据库(基于YUM包管理器) 在Linux系统中,MySQL作为一种广泛使用的关系型数据库管理系统,为无数应用程序提供了强大的数据存储和检索功能

    然而,在某些情况下,我们可能需要从系统中移除MySQL,比如为了更换数据库解决方案、减轻系统资源负担,或是进行彻底的服务器环境清理

    对于基于RPM包的Linux发行版(如CentOS、RHEL及其衍生版),YUM包管理器是管理软件包的强大工具

    本文将详细介绍如何使用YUM高效且彻底地删除MySQL数据库,确保系统环境的整洁与安全

     一、为什么需要卸载MySQL? 在深入探讨卸载步骤之前,了解卸载MySQL的原因至关重要

    这有助于我们更好地理解卸载过程中的注意事项,确保操作不会对系统其他部分造成不必要的影响

    常见的卸载原因包括但不限于: 1.资源优化:对于资源有限的服务器,卸载不再使用的MySQL可以释放内存、CPU和磁盘空间,提高系统整体性能

     2.版本升级或替换:有时候,需要升级到MySQL的新版本或替换为其他数据库系统,以满足应用的新需求

     3.安全考虑:如果MySQL存在已知的安全漏洞且无法及时修补,卸载并替换为更安全的版本或解决方案可能是最佳选择

     4.项目终止:随着项目的结束,支持该项目的MySQL数据库可能不再需要,卸载可以减少维护成本

     二、准备工作 在动手卸载之前,做好以下准备工作,可以大大降低操作风险: 1.数据备份:这是最重要的一步

    在卸载MySQL之前,务必备份所有重要的数据库数据

    可以使用`mysqldump`工具导出数据库,或者使用其他备份方案

     2.服务停止:确保MySQL服务已经停止运行,避免在卸载过程中发生数据损坏或服务冲突

    可以使用命令`systemctl stop mysqld`或`service mysqld stop`来停止服务

     3.检查依赖:使用`yum list installed | grep mysql`查看系统中安装的所有与MySQL相关的软件包,了解卸载可能影响的范围

     三、使用YUM卸载MySQL 步骤1:列出MySQL相关软件包 首先,我们需要确定系统中安装了哪些与MySQL相关的软件包

    执行以下命令: bash yum list installed | grep mysql 此命令将列出所有已安装的包含“mysql”字样的软件包

    记录下这些软件包名称,因为稍后我们将逐一卸载它们

     步骤2:逐一卸载软件包 由于MySQL可能包含多个依赖包(如服务器、客户端、开发库等),我们需要逐一卸载这些包

    使用以下命令格式进行卸载: bash yum remove 将`

nat123映射怎么用?超详细步骤,外网访问内网轻松搞定
nat123域名怎么用?两种方式轻松搞定
nat123怎么用?简单几步实现内网穿透
内网穿透工具对比:nat123、花生壳与轻量新选择
远程访问内网很简单:用对工具,一“箭”穿透
ngrok下载完全指南:从入门到获取客户端
内网远程桌面软件:穿透局域网边界的数字窗口
从外网远程访问内网服务器的完整方案
Windows Server 2008端口转发完全教程:netsh命令添加/查看/删除/重置
为什么三层交换机转发比Linux服务器快?转发表硬件加速的秘密